Start with the load profile

A solar design should begin with when the villa uses electricity. Annual consumption alone cannot show whether demand falls in the middle of the day, after sunset or mainly during a few busy summer months.

Bills provide a starting point. Pool schedules, air conditioning, electric water heating, cooking, vehicle charging and occupancy then explain the peaks behind the total. That distinction affects the array size, inverter and whether storage is likely to be useful.

Surveying the roof and electrical installation

The roof survey records usable areas, orientation, pitch, shading, access and the condition of the mounting surface. Jávea villas often have several roof sections rather than one uninterrupted plane, so a drawing based on satellite imagery is only an initial indication.

The electrical survey checks the supply, consumer unit, earthing, cable route and suitable positions for the inverter and any battery. A three-phase supply or an older electrical installation can change the design and should be identified before the quotation is fixed.

Choosing the array and inverter together

Panel layout and inverter selection are connected decisions. A clean roof may suit a conventional string inverter. Roofs with several orientations or recurring shade may justify Enphase microinverters and panel-level monitoring.

A SolaX hybrid inverter may suit a design that includes compatible battery storage or allows for it later. Battery compatibility, backup requirements, monitoring and possible expansion are easier to provide when they are specified at the beginning.

Full-time homes and holiday villas

A full-time home usually has a steadier base load and more evening consumption. A holiday villa can have long quiet periods followed by heavy demand from cooling, pool equipment and guests.

Sizing from the busiest August bill can leave a holiday property exporting surplus for much of the year. Sizing only from a quiet month can leave useful summer demand uncovered. The proposal should show which pattern it has been designed around.

Planning for air conditioning, pool heating and EV charging

New electrical loads can materially change the value of solar. If Kosner air conditioning, pool heating or an electric vehicle is planned, the expected usage and likely operating times should be included.

This does not always mean fitting the maximum possible number of panels immediately. It may mean choosing an inverter and electrical layout that allow the system to expand without replacing major components.

What a useful proposal should show

A proposal should make the reasoning visible. It should show the panel layout, expected production, inverter arrangement, storage assumptions and the main loads the design is intended to offset.

Savings estimates are only useful when the electricity price, self-consumption level and occupancy assumptions are stated. We explain those assumptions so different options can be compared on the same basis.

Can a solar system be designed from electricity bills alone?

Bills are useful, but they do not fully show when electricity is used. Occupancy, pool schedules, cooling, heating and other large loads need to be understood as well.

Does a three-phase supply affect the design?

It can. The inverter and connection arrangement must suit the property’s electrical supply and comply with the requirements that apply to the installation.

Should I allow for a future battery?

If storage is a realistic future plan, choosing compatible equipment and a suitable installation layout now can avoid unnecessary replacement work later.

Can the system be expanded later?

Sometimes. Expansion depends on roof space, inverter capacity, electrical limits and the compatibility of additional equipment. It is best treated as a design requirement from the start.
